My Buying Guides on Heated Boots For Men
Why I Consider Heated Boots
When I look for heated boots, my first priority is staying warm without sacrificing comfort. I want boots that can handle cold mornings, long outdoor walks, and winter work conditions. For me, heated boots are worth it if they provide consistent warmth, good battery life, and reliable construction.
Heating Performance
The most important thing I check is how well the boots heat up. I look for adjustable heat settings so I can control the temperature based on the weather. I also prefer boots that warm the entire foot evenly, especially the toes and sole, since those are the areas that get cold fastest for me.
Battery Life
Battery life matters a lot in my decision. If I plan to be outside for several hours, I need boots that can last through the day on a single charge. I usually compare the runtime on low, medium, and high settings because I know higher heat often drains the battery faster.
Comfort and Fit
Even if the boots are heated, they still need to feel comfortable. I always pay attention to sizing, cushioning, arch support, and weight. If the boots feel too heavy or too tight, I know I won’t want to wear them for long periods.
Material and Insulation
I prefer boots made with durable, weather-resistant materials. Leather, waterproof synthetics, and strong insulation help keep my feet dry and warm. Good insulation also means the boots can hold heat better, which makes the heating system more effective.
Waterproofing and Weather Protection
For me, waterproofing is a must if I expect snow, slush, or rain. I look for sealed seams and water-resistant outer materials so moisture doesn’t get inside. I also like boots with good traction because icy ground can be a real problem in winter.
Ease of Charging
I always check how the boots charge and whether the battery is easy to remove. A simple charging system makes my life easier, especially if I travel often. I also like it when the charging time is reasonable and the battery indicator is easy to understand.
Durability and Build Quality
I want heated boots that can handle regular use, not just occasional wear. Strong stitching, solid soles, and reliable heating elements matter to me. If the boots look flimsy, I usually skip them because I know winter conditions can be tough.
Style and Use Case
I choose heated boots based on how I plan to use them. If I need them for work, I look for rugged, practical designs. If I want them for casual winter wear, I focus more on style and comfort. I try to pick a pair that matches both my needs and my personal taste.
